编译arm-linux平台的FFMPEG+X264成库文件

1.首先下载x264的源文件和FFMPEG的源文件都是最新源文件: git clone http://git.videolan.org/git/x264.git  可以获得x264 http://ffmpeg.org/download.html    version 3.4.2   放入你想要的目录文件夹下我的/home/workplace。 解压...

Linux永久性修改IP地址

1.配置网卡IP地址 vi /etc/sysconfig/network-scripts/ifcfg-eth0    #第二块网卡:vi /etc/sysconfig/network-scripts/ifcfg-eth1 DEVICE=eth0                                #物理设备名IPADDR=192...

由 cat /proc/iomem 所学到的

由 cat /proc/iomem 所学到的 1)cat /proc/iomem看到的内容: IO memory空间的地址资源分配情况,以树状结构显示。 request_mem_region ioremap 2)cat /proc/ioports看到的内容 IO port空间的地址资源分配情况,以树状结构显示。[源于x86...

在linux上搭建lua开发环境

1.获取lua源码 源码下载地址:http://www.lua.org/download.html 我下载的版本是:lua-5.3.4 2.解压lua源码 tar xvf lua-5.3.4.tar.gz 3.编译lua源码 输入命令: make linux install 提示错误 gcc -std=gnu99 -O2 -Wall -Wextra -DLUA_C...

linux 内核崩溃处理

pc : [1.txt c0034818 T __kmalloc ... c00082a8 t quiet_kernel /*最开始的是虚拟地址*/ ... bf000000  t $a [cdd] .. 由此可看代码崩溃在xxx.ko 2.定位崩溃在xxx.ko中的哪个函数 arm-linux-objdump -D cdd.ko >2.txt 00000000 0: e...

Linux 串口 一次性read接收不定长的数据(非阻塞,非延时) 程序分析

二话不说,直接上代码。/*********************Copyright(c)************************************************************************ ** Guangzhou ZHIYUAN electronics Co.,LTD ** ** http://www.embedtools.com...

抢占式内核与非抢占式内核的区别

内核抢占(可抢占式内核): 即当进程位于内核空间时,有一个更高优先级的任务出现时,如果当前内核允许抢占,则可以将当前任务挂起,执行优先级更高的进程。 非抢占式内核: 高优先级的进程不能中止正在内核中运行的低优先级的进程而抢占...

linux下c程序c++程序混合编译,c程序中调用c++程序,c语言项目与c++语言项目的合并

博主目的是把两个开源项目合并到一起,但是一个是c编写,一个是c++编写,在linux环境下实现两个项目的融合,以及互相的调用。 首先编译,先贴出来我的makefile文件: GPU=1 OPENCV=1 DEBUG=0 ARCH= --gpu-architecture=compute_30 --gpu-co...

zlog 交叉编译

1. zlog 是个很好的写程序日志的库,功能比较强大,上手快。 2. 下载地址:https://github.com/bmanojlovic/zlog 3. cd 到文件夹下,对 autogen.sh 添加可执行权限:chmod +x autogen.sh     然后执行:./autogen.sh     如果出现不能...

Electron开发入门

首先需要安装NodeJS。 设置npm, npm config set registry "https://registry.npm.taobao.org/" 安装Electron可以有多种方式。 第一种方式:直接下载软件包 https://github.com/electron/electron/releases 第二种方式:通过npm安装electro...

I2C分析及RX8025驱动编写

一、        I2C 1.    I2C概要 I2C总线由SDA和SCL构成的2线式双向通信,通过组合这2个信号,进行通信的开始/停止/数据传送/应答等接收信号。 非通信时:SDA、SCL都保持高电平。 通信的开始和结束通过SCL处于高电平,切上升或...

Qt5.5.0编译移植到Linux-Arm-A9

Qt5.5.0编译移植到Linux-Arm-A9 时间:2015-07-04 14:10:36      阅读:2167      评论:0      收藏:0      [点我收藏+] 标签:android   style   com   http   src   it   文件   la   问...

Linux下如何挂载NTFS格式U盘(替代法)

sudo fdisk -l /dev/sda    //查询是否有U盘接入 Device Boot Start End Blocks Id System /dev/sda2 * 1 2668 128016 6 FAT16           看了上面的输出就知道U盘所在的设备了,接着便是挂载了 mount -t msdos /dev/sda2 /mnt...

句柄泄露调试

句柄泄露调试(Handles Leak Debug) 一、概述 造成句柄泄露的主要原因,是进程在调用系统文件之后,没有释放已经打开的文件句柄。 对于句柄泄露,轻则影响某个功能模块正常运行,重则导致整个应用程序崩溃。在 Windows系统中, ...

我使用过的Linux命令之usleep - 延迟以微秒为单位的时间

我使用过的Linux命令之usleep - 延迟以微秒为单位的时间 本文链接:http://codingstandards.iteye.com/blog/1007783   (转载请注明出处)   用途说明 usleep命令用于延迟以微秒为单位的时间(sleep some number of microseconds),实际...

发布经验,赚取财富值,与更多的电子工程师一起成长!

写文章

热门文章

一周热门问题